Start by building a steady production loop

In Idle Farm, the smartest early move is usually to secure a reliable base before chasing flashy upgrades. That means focusing on the parts of the farm that give you consistent returns and help the next purchase happen sooner. When a game is built around idle progress, every upgrade should make the next cycle faster, not just make the screen look busier.

When I tested the flow, the biggest mistake was spreading resources too thin. A stronger approach is to pick the upgrade path that clearly improves generation speed or output value, then commit to it long enough to feel the difference. That is the heart of good idle farm tips and upgrades: you want the farm to grow on its own while you guide the direction.

  • Prioritize upgrades that improve income first.
  • Reinvest early gains instead of saving too long.
  • Check which action shortens the next expansion step.
  • Avoid buying everything evenly if one path is clearly stronger.

Choose upgrades that speed up the next decision

The best upgrade is not always the biggest-looking one. In idle games, a useful upgrade is the one that changes your pace in a noticeable way. If an upgrade helps you reach the next milestone faster, it is often better than a cosmetic-feeling boost or a small side bonus. That principle matters a lot for idle farm tips and upgrades because efficiency compounds over time.

Read upgrade text carefully and ask one question: does this help my farm produce more per minute, or does it only help in a narrow situation? In a Casual browser game like Idle Farm, the more general benefit usually wins. If you are unsure, try the option that improves your core loop first, then compare how quickly the next purchase becomes available.

Play in short sessions and let idle gains work

One of the best things about Idle Farm is that it fits naturally into quick check-ins. You do not have to sit there for a long grind; instead, let the game work in the background of your attention and return when it makes sense to spend again. That rhythm is especially useful for browser play, because it keeps the game relaxed while still moving forward.

Short sessions also help you learn which purchases are actually useful. If you notice one upgrade consistently leads to faster growth, make that part of your default routine. If another choice barely changes your pace, skip it next time. Over a few sessions, you will develop a better sense of timing and a clearer priority order for idle farm tips and upgrades.
